Transaction 21d14779ac21e3c707c26218f26e1e4f98cedcccc855dd297238a8a51976f542

1 Input
2 Outputs
  • 21d14779ac21e3c707c26218f26e1e4f98cedcccc855dd297238a8a51976f542:0
  • value  84923
    address  3EXyxqzLFEqLenSMhA6ZXe3uPGrWZZ7CwZ
  • 21d14779ac21e3c707c26218f26e1e4f98cedcccc855dd297238a8a51976f542:1
  • value  3272561
    address  1CF1XdsLJcUAHrUuzLP4bbrnGmtNM28S9C